Battlefield 1, Battlefront 1,2 Battlefield 5 all have aim-assist on PC for controller users. You can disable and/ or enable it in the settings.

Most titles after 2016 have aim assist on PC while using a controller (not saying all).

EDIT

Aim assist is a personal preference, not a requirement for controller users. There are competitive titles on consoles that don't have aim assistance that do just fine without it.
